| Index: chrome/browser/extensions/user_script_listener_unittest.cc
|
| diff --git a/chrome/browser/extensions/user_script_listener_unittest.cc b/chrome/browser/extensions/user_script_listener_unittest.cc
|
| index e14cb10c38c6b90e7f179abfeb48c1f532265103..65cb7e6ff7cd5abc7dc6dff66bc319011f4b12af 100644
|
| --- a/chrome/browser/extensions/user_script_listener_unittest.cc
|
| +++ b/chrome/browser/extensions/user_script_listener_unittest.cc
|
| @@ -19,6 +19,7 @@
|
| #include "net/base/request_priority.h"
|
| #include "net/url_request/url_request.h"
|
| #include "net/url_request/url_request_filter.h"
|
| +#include "net/url_request/url_request_interceptor.h"
|
| #include "net/url_request/url_request_test_job.h"
|
| #include "net/url_request/url_request_test_util.h"
|
| #include "testing/gtest/include/gtest/gtest.h"
|
| @@ -101,21 +102,21 @@ scoped_refptr<Extension> LoadExtension(const std::string& filename,
|
| Extension::NO_FLAGS, error);
|
| }
|
|
|
| -class SimpleTestJobProtocolHandler
|
| - : public net::URLRequestJobFactory::ProtocolHandler {
|
| +class SimpleTestJobURLRequestInterceptor
|
| + : public net::URLRequestInterceptor {
|
| public:
|
| - SimpleTestJobProtocolHandler() {}
|
| - virtual ~SimpleTestJobProtocolHandler() {}
|
| + SimpleTestJobURLRequestInterceptor() {}
|
| + virtual ~SimpleTestJobURLRequestInterceptor() {}
|
|
|
| // net::URLRequestJobFactory::ProtocolHandler
|
| - virtual net::URLRequestJob* MaybeCreateJob(
|
| + virtual net::URLRequestJob* MaybeInterceptRequest(
|
| net::URLRequest* request,
|
| net::NetworkDelegate* network_delegate) const OVERRIDE {
|
| return new SimpleTestJob(request, network_delegate);
|
| }
|
|
|
| private:
|
| - DISALLOW_COPY_AND_ASSIGN(SimpleTestJobProtocolHandler);
|
| + DISALLOW_COPY_AND_ASSIGN(SimpleTestJobURLRequestInterceptor);
|
| };
|
|
|
| } // namespace
|
| @@ -123,14 +124,14 @@ class SimpleTestJobProtocolHandler
|
| class UserScriptListenerTest : public ExtensionServiceTestBase {
|
| public:
|
| UserScriptListenerTest() {
|
| - net::URLRequestFilter::GetInstance()->AddHostnameProtocolHandler(
|
| + net::URLRequestFilter::GetInstance()->AddHostnameInterceptor(
|
| "http", "google.com",
|
| - scoped_ptr<net::URLRequestJobFactory::ProtocolHandler>(
|
| - new SimpleTestJobProtocolHandler()));
|
| - net::URLRequestFilter::GetInstance()->AddHostnameProtocolHandler(
|
| + scoped_ptr<net::URLRequestInterceptor>(
|
| + new SimpleTestJobURLRequestInterceptor()));
|
| + net::URLRequestFilter::GetInstance()->AddHostnameInterceptor(
|
| "http", "example.com",
|
| - scoped_ptr<net::URLRequestJobFactory::ProtocolHandler>(
|
| - new SimpleTestJobProtocolHandler()));
|
| + scoped_ptr<net::URLRequestInterceptor>(
|
| + new SimpleTestJobURLRequestInterceptor()));
|
| }
|
|
|
| virtual ~UserScriptListenerTest() {
|
|
|